#584c2c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#584c2c is composed of 34.5% red, 29.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.6% magenta, 50%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 43.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 25.9%. #584c2c color hex could be obtained by blending #b09858 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#584c2c color description : Very dark desaturated orange.

#584c2c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#584c2c has RGB values of R:88, G:76,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.5,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5786668.

Hex triplet 584c2c #584c2c
RGB Decimal 88, 76, 44 rgb(88,76,44)
RGB Percent 34.5, 29.8, 17.3 rgb(34.5%,29.8%,17.3%)
CMYK 0, 14, 50, 65
HSL 43.6°, 33.3, 25.9 hsl(43.6,33.3%,25.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 43.6°, 50, 34.5
Web Safe 663333 #663333
CIE-LAB 32.757, 0.057, 20.813
XYZ 7.064, 7.426, 3.444
xyY 0.394, 0.414, 7.426
CIE-LCH 32.757, 20.813, 89.844
CIE-LUV 32.757, 9.181, 21.555
Hunter-Lab 27.25, -1.418, 11.582
Binary 01011000, 01001100, 00101100

Shades and Tints of #584c2c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0805 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#584c2c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444340 is the less saturated color, while #815e03 is the most saturated one.
